I. General Information

  • Full name: Ha Thi Bac

  • Year of birth: 1980

  • E-mail:habac@vnu.edu.vn

  • Affiliation: Faculty of Philosophy and Management

  • Academic title: None Year of appointment: None

  • Academic degree: PhD Year received: 2015

  • Training process:

- 1999 - 2003: University, Department of Political Education, Hanoi Pedagogical University.

- 2007 - 2010: Master's degree in Philosophy, Center for Training and Development of Political Theory Lecturers - Vietnam National University, Hanoi.

- 2011 - 2015: PhD, Philosophy, Faculty of Social Sciences and Humanities, Vietnam National University, Hanoi

  • Foreign language proficiency: English

  • Main research areas: Marxist-Leninist philosophy; scientific socialism; philosophy of education; family studies and gender equality.
